About
Brothers Osborne is a dynamic country rock duo hailing from Deale, Maryland, comprised of siblings John Osborne (guitar, vocals) and TJ Osborne (lead vocals, guitar). Known for blending modern country with southern rock influences, the brothers have crafted a sound that appeals to both traditional and contemporary country fans. Their music, infused with heartfelt storytelling and a touch of rock and roll grit, has positioned them as influential figures in the evolving Nashville scene.
How to Sound Like Brothers Osborne
The sound of Brothers Osborne is characterized by a rich, gritty guitar tone and soulful vocal harmonies. With a penchant for weaving intricate guitar work into their songs, John Osborne often employs the Fender Telecaster B-Bender and Gibson Custom Shop 1959 Les Paul Standard R9 - Cherry Teaburst to achieve both twangy and robust tonal qualities. Utilizing effects like the Eventide H9 Max, their soundscape blends classic country warmth with modern sonic depth. The duo's music thrives on a balance of melodic and rhythmic elements, creating a textured and engaging listening experience that is both grounded and expansive.
